Ethnobiology is a fascinating science. To understand this vocation it needs to be studied under an evolutionary point of view that is very strong and significant, although this aspect is often poorly approached in the literature. This is the first book to compile and discuss information about evolutionary ethnobiology in English.

Ulysses Paulino Albuquerque Laboratory of Applied and Theoretical Ethnobiology Department of Biology Federal Rural University of Pernambuco Recife, Pernambuco, Brazil

Evolutionary Ethnobiology.- Ecological-evolutionary Approaches to the Human-environment Relationship: History and Concepts.- Evolution of Humans and by Humans.- Evolutionary Ecology and Ethnobiology.- Evolutionary Approaches to Ethnobiology.- Niche Construction Theory and Ethnobiology.- Knowledge Transmission: The Social Origin of Information and Cultural Evolution.- Resilience and Adaptation in Social-ecological Systems.- Utilitarian Redundancy: Conceptualization and Potential Applications in Ethnobiological Research.- The Influence of the Environment on Natural Resource Use: Evidence of Apparency.- Local Criteria for Medicinal Plant Selection.- Use Patterns of Medicinal Plants by Local Populations.- Biological and Cultural Bases of the Use of Medicinal and Food Plants.- An Evolutionary Perspective on the Use of Hallucinogens.
